Is Fruitvale its own city?
No. Fruitvale is a neighborhood within the City of Oakland, not a separate municipality. It is policed by the Oakland Police Department (OPD), and its criminal cases are prosecuted by the Alameda County District Attorney at the courthouses in downtown Oakland. Despite its strong community identity, Fruitvale’s jurisdiction is Oakland.

Will a Fruitvale criminal case affect my immigration status?
It can — even for U.S. citizens with non-citizen family members, and certainly for non-citizens. Crimes involving moral turpitude (CIMTs), aggravated felonies, controlled-substance offenses, and domestic-violence convictions all trigger removability or inadmissibility consequences. We coordinate criminal defense with immigration-attorney consultation from intake to avoid plea outcomes that create deportation exposure (the Padilla v. Kentucky standard).
How are Fruitvale gang-enhancement allegations defended?
California’s gang-enhancement statute (PC §186.22) was substantially narrowed by AB 333 (2022). The prosecution now must prove the gang’s primary activities are more than incidental, that predicate offenses were committed collectively by gang members, and that the charged offense commonly benefits the gang in more than a reputational way. We file AB 333 challenges, bifurcation motions, and Sanchez objections to hearsay-based gang-expert testimony.
